Whilst we do not hold any health data, HDR UK is establishing the UK’s health data research infrastructure through:

  • Uniting health data by bringing together the UK’s datasets and making them safely and securely discoverable and accessible for research through the UK Health Data Alliance and Innovation Gateway, in a way that earns the trust of patients and the public.
  • Improving health data by providing tools, methods, hubs, and national expertise in health data quality improvement for researchers and innovators.
  • Enabling research and innovation that has a large-scale impact, demonstrating novel approaches to health data use,and establishing an expert group of national research leaders in health data science.
